How Standing Water Removal Works in Clinton, MD

Standing water removal is not just about extracting the water; it’s about restoring your home to its original condition. Our team uses specialized equipment to detect hidden water damage which is crucial to preventing further problems. We’ll also contain the affected area to prevent water from spreading and causing more damage.

Step 1: Inspection and Assessment

Our team conducts a thorough inspection to find out the extent of the damage and identify any potential issues. This helps us create a customized plan to restore your home to its original condition.

Step 2: Containment and Equipment Setup

We set up specialized equipment to contain the affected area and prevent water from spreading. This includes moisture meters to detect hidden water damage and extraction units to remove standing water.

Step 3: Extraction and Drying

Our team uses high-velocity air movers to dry the affected area quickly and efficiently. We also use dehumidifiers to remove excess moisture from the air and prevent further damage.

Step 4: Disinfection and Sanitizing

We use specialized equipment to disinfect and sanitize the affected area, ensuring that your home is free from mold and bacterial growth. This is crucial to preventing health issues and further damage.

Step 5: Final Inspection and Restoration

Our team conducts a final inspection to ensure that your home has been fully restored to its original condition. We’ll also provide you with a comprehensive report detailing the work done and any recommendations for future maintenance.

Warning Signs You Need Standing Water Removal

Ignoring warning signs can lead to costly repairs and health issues. That’s why it’s essential to catch these signs early and take action. Here are some common warning signs of standing water damage: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

A musty smell is usually a sign of hidden water damage or mold growth. If you notice a persistent musty smell in your home, it’s essential to investigate the source and take action immediately.

Warped or Buckled Floors

Warped or buckled floors are a clear indication of water damage. If you notice this on your floors, it’s time to call a professional to assess the situation and provide a solution.

Discolored Walls or Ceilings

Discolored walls or ceilings are a sign of water damage or mold growth. If you notice this in your home, it’s essential to investigate the source and take action to prevent further damage.

Peeling Paint or Wallpaper

Peeling paint or wallpaper is a sign of water damage or high humidity. If you notice this in your home, it’s essential to investigate the source and take action to prevent further damage.

Soggy Insulation or Drywall

Soggy insulation or drywall is a clear indication of water damage. If you notice this in your home, it’s essential to call a professional to assess the situation and provide a solution.

Noticeable Water Stains

Noticeable water stains on your walls or ceiling are a sign of water damage. If you notice this in your home, it’s essential to investigate the source and take action to prevent further damage.

Standing Water Removal vs. DIY: When to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small amount of water (less than 100 sq. Ft.) Yes No DIY methods are effective for small areas.
Large amount of water (more than 100 sq. Ft.) No Yes Professional equipment is required for large areas.
Hidden water damage or musty odors No Yes Professional methods are required to detect hidden water damage.
High humidity or mold growth No Yes Professional methods are required to eradicate mold growth.
Water damage in critical areas (e.g., electrical or HVAC systems) No Yes Professional methods are required to prevent further damage to critical systems.
Insurance claim or complex issue No Yes Professional methods are required to navigate insurance claims and complex issues.

Standing Water Removal Cost in Clinton, MD

Prices for standing water removal vary based on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Clinton, MD. Here are some estimated price ranges for different services: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Standing Water Removal (small area) $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area, severity of damage
Standing Water Removal (large area) $2,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area, severity of damage, equipment required
Disinfection and Sanitizing $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area, severity of damage
Moisture Meter Inspection $100 – $500 Size of affected area, severity of damage
Equipment Rental (per day) $50 – $200 Size of affected area, severity of damage

Common Questions About Standing Water Removal

Q: What causes standing water in my home?

A: Standing water in your home can be caused by various factors, including leaky pipes appliance malfunctions flood damage and high humidity. It’s essential to investigate the source and take action to prevent further damage.

Q: Can I use a wet/dry vacuum to remove standing water?

A: While a wet/dry vacuum can be used to remove standing water it’s not always the best solution. Professional equipment is often required to detect hidden water damage and prevent further issues.

Q: How long does it take to dry a home after standing water removal?

A: The time it takes to dry a home after standing water removal depends on various factors, including the size of the affected area the severity of the damage and the humidity levels.
